Building a Gentle Shelter: The Bonds of Marriage

Marriage is often regarded as one of the most significant journeys two individuals can embark on together. It’s a partnership that promises not only love and companionship but also the creation of a shared life that is both fulfilling and nurturing. In this publication, we will explore the multifaceted nature of marriage, focusing on the metaphor of building a gentle shelter—a safe haven where love, understanding, and growth can flourish.

The Foundation of Trust

Just as a sturdy building requires a solid foundation, a successful marriage is built on trust. Trust is the bedrock of any relationship; it allows individuals to feel safe and secure in their partnership. Without it, the structure of marriage can become fragile and susceptible to external stresses. Building trust takes time and consistency, as partners must demonstrate reliability in their words and actions.

Communication: The Framework

Effective communication is like the framework of a shelter, holding everything together. Open, honest dialogue fosters understanding and connection. Couples should practice active listening, ensuring that both partners feel heard and valued. This means not only discussing joys and successes but also addressing conflicts and areas of concern. The ability to navigate tough conversations is crucial for maintaining the integrity of the relationship.

The Importance of Vulnerability

Vulnerability plays a vital role in communication. By allowing ourselves to be open and honest about our feelings, fears, and desires, we invite our partners to do the same. This shared vulnerability deepens emotional intimacy and cements the bond between partners. It is essential to create an environment where both individuals feel comfortable expressing their true selves without fear of judgment.

Love and Affection: The Warmth Within

Love is the warmth that fills the shelter of marriage, providing comfort and joy. It is crucial to express love regularly through words, actions, and gestures, reinforcing the bond between partners. Small acts of kindness, such as leaving sweet notes or planning surprise dates, can significantly impact the relationship, reminding each other of the affection that sparked the union in the first place.

Quality Time: Building Memories

Spending quality time together is essential for nurturing love and affection. In our fast-paced world, it can be easy to let daily responsibilities take precedence over connection. However, intentionally setting aside time to engage in activities that both partners enjoy can strengthen the relationship. Whether it’s regular date nights, weekend getaways, or simply cooking together, these shared experiences create lasting memories and deepen the relationship.

Shared Goals and Aspirations: The Roof Overhead

Every shelter needs a roof to protect its inhabitants from the storms of life. In marriage, shared goals and aspirations act as this protective covering. Couples should discuss their dreams, both individually and as a unit, creating a vision of the future they want to build together. This shared vision fosters unity and encourages partners to work collaboratively towards common objectives.

Supporting Each Other’s Growth

In a gentle shelter, partners support each other’s individual growth. It’s essential to encourage one another to pursue personal goals and interests. This not only benefits the individuals but also enriches the marriage. When both partners thrive, the relationship becomes stronger, as each person brings new experiences and perspectives into the partnership.

Conflict Resolution: Weathering the Storms

No marriage is without its challenges. Conflicts are a natural part of any relationship, and how couples address these conflicts can determine the longevity and health of their marriage. It is crucial to approach disagreements with respect and a willingness to understand the other’s perspective. By focusing on problem-solving rather than winning arguments, couples can navigate through storms and emerge stronger.

The Art of Compromise

Compromise is an essential skill in marriage. It requires partners to balance their needs and desires while finding solutions that work for both. Learning to let go of the need to be right and embracing collaboration is key to resolving conflicts harmoniously. When couples engage in compromise, they create an environment where both individuals feel valued and respected.
